Sesquiterpene lactones from the aerial parts of Inula oculus-christi
(Elsevier, 2003)
Pulchellin E (1) and gaillardin (2) were isolated from the aerial parts of Inula oculus-christi, along with the flavone hispidulin. The C-13-NMR chemical shifts of 1 and 2 are reported.
